My reasons for TS

>TS is one of the heavy weights. I think volume wise it is in top 10. so u can get in and out with good size with no problems.
>TS is trendy ...not too much not too less just the right amount.
>TS is heavy meaning in case of huge selling/buying it will decrease/increase at a steady pace compared light stocks which might drop like a rock or bounce suddenly so more risk to your SL.
>It gives plenty of time before turning.
>TS rarely have big gap up/downs. compared to lets say bank stocks
>Also inherent smooth nature. (hard do describe this in a technical way). Other stocks may have some hidden noise
>TS is independent to index movement meaning Index does not influence TS movement. Most stocks are heavily influenced by Index it leads to unnatural price action.
>TS nature is consistent throughout the year barring some weeks here n there. other stocks may change nature sometimes for months

With recent volatility i think there are many stocks which are better than TS. But not so long ago when everything was quite I think TS was very good.
Please note I might be biased I have a spend a lot of time with TS compared to others.
